People in This Verse
Samuel became a major prophet and leader in Israel, anointing the first two kings. His birth was a direct answer to Hannah's fervent prayers.
First appearance: 1 Samuel 1:20
Saul was the first king of Israel, chosen by God but later rejected for disobedience. His life serves as a cautionary tale about pride and the consequences of turning away from God.
First appearance: 1 Samuel 9:1
Places in This Verse
Ramah was a significant city in the territory of Benjamin and served as a central location for Samuel's ministry.
